- W2360897894 abstract "This paper is aimed to introduce the author's study on the effects of Mg~(2+), Mn~(2+), Ni~(2+), Zn~(2+), Co~(2+) and Mo~(6+)on the activity of the activated sludge (AS). The aerobic activated sludge can be used for wastewater treatment, with some metals needed to participate in the bacterial metabolism process. However, what mental and how many quantities are needed remains a controversial problem for a long time. In our study, we introduced six mental ions into a bench-scale reactor respectively. The reactor was then simulated for a SBR aerobic activated sludge process for domestic wastewater purification. At the beginning of every SBR processing period, different mental ions with different concentration were added into the reactor. After the mixed liquor was settled at the end of SBR processing period, the activated sludge was drawn from the reactor and the specific oxygen uptaking rate (SOUR) and dehydrogenase activity (DHA) of AS were determined to reflect their activities. The experimental results show that, SOUR and DHA of activated sludge are dramatically declined when Co~(2+) is added with a concentration no more than 2 mg/L into the reactor. Thus, it can seen that Co~(2+) shows a certain inhibition effect on the activity of AS. When other five metals were added into the reactor respectively, the stimulating effect could be observed, for SOUR and DHA of activated sludge were ascended. When the concentration turned to be within the range of 0.5~3 mg/L, 0.5~5 mg/L, 0.5~1 mg/L, 5~20 mg/L, 0.25~1 mg/L respectively, Mg~(2+), Mo~(6+), Zn~(2+), Mg~(2+), and Ni~(2+) would show their stimulating effect on the activated sludge activity. Comparing each best effect on the activity of AS, the stimulating sequence will be: Mg~(2+)Mn~(2+)Zn~(2+)N~(2+)Mo~(6+)." @default.
